Market Price in Crypto Futures Trading

The **market price** is the current price at which an asset, such as Bitcoin or Ethereum, can be bought or sold in the market. In crypto futures trading, understanding the market price is crucial as it determines the entry and exit points for your trades. This article will explain the concept of market price, its importance, and how to use it effectively in crypto futures trading.

What is Market Price?

The market price is the price at which buyers and sellers agree to trade an asset. It reflects the supply and demand dynamics of the market. In crypto futures trading, the market price is influenced by factors such as trading volume, market sentiment, and macroeconomic events.

For example, if the market price of Bitcoin is $30,000, it means that buyers are willing to pay $30,000 per Bitcoin, and sellers are willing to sell at that price.

How Market Price Works in Crypto Futures

In crypto futures trading, traders speculate on the future price of an asset. Unlike spot trading, where you buy or sell the asset immediately, futures trading involves contracts that expire at a specific date in the future. The market price in futures trading is the price at which these contracts are traded.

For instance, if you believe the price of Ethereum will rise in the next month, you can open a **long position** at the current market price. If the market price increases by the expiration date, you can close the position at a profit.

Risk Management Tips

Crypto futures trading can be highly volatile, so managing risk is essential. Here are some tips:

1. **Use Stop-Loss Orders**: Set a stop-loss order to automatically close your position if the market price moves against you. 2. **Avoid Over-Leveraging**: High leverage can amplify both profits and losses. Start with lower leverage until you’re comfortable. 3. **Diversify Your Portfolio**: Don’t put all your funds into a single trade. Spread your investments across different assets. 4. **Stay Informed**: Keep up with market news and trends to make informed decisions.

Examples of Crypto Futures Trades

Here are two examples to illustrate how market price works in crypto futures trading:

    • Example 1: Long Position on Bitcoin**
  • Market Price: $30,000
  • You open a long position with 10x leverage.
  • If the market price rises to $33,000, you make a profit.
  • If the market price drops to $28,000, you incur a loss.
    • Example 2: Short Position on Ethereum**
  • Market Price: $2,000
  • You open a short position with 5x leverage.
  • If the market price drops to $1,800, you make a profit.
  • If the market price rises to $2,100, you incur a loss.
